Navtool Review

I just paid $100 just have the local shop install the Navtool in my TL Tech Advance.

The installer said it was a very straighforward install. He did mention that it was so cramped behind the radio with all the wires and the box that it took 2 people to hold the wires and tuck everything in while sliding the radio back.
(also make sure your installer has the radio code so they can test the unit.) We could't test it until I came to pick up the car.

I did notice an extremely slight whine in the audio feed that seems to stay in line with the alternator, but I'm pretty sure that is because of the cables being so scrunched together. It is extremely slight and WAY better than my last Nav Module in my 2005 TL that had an FM modulator.

I bought a 6' component cable from Amazon and I had the installer run it inside the center console. there is about 2' of slack with is just enough room for me to control the iphone while plugged in.

I bought an app called Goodplayer that so far has been playing all sorts of video types with no problems.

I am very pleased with this device so far. I'll give it a good workout in the next few weeks and post more feedback. Well worth the $. Thanks again Navtool for making this a reality.

I totally know where you are coming from! I followed this thread as well and was disappointed to learn that the final product did not have all of the features that their first video claimed to have.

The product I purchased from them will only switch between the component video input and the car's stock navi/audio screen. This is accomplished by pressing and holding the cancel button on the dash for 3 seconds.

For me, I would have liked more options, especially an HDMI input for my Droid RAZR, but I got tired of waiting.
